I’ve been having serious performance issues when trying to watch videos on Unity Learn. The videos often lag or stop completely, and sometimes I can only watch for a short while before playback freezes. Even images on the site take a very long time to load — it feels like using the internet back in the 90s when pictures loaded line by line.
Here’s what I’ve already tried:
Different web browsers (Chrome and Firefox)
Different computers
Safe mode
Clearing the browser cache
Trying at different times of the day
Despite all that, the issue persists. I should also mention that my internet connection is stable and fast. I have no problems streaming videos from YouTube, Vimeo, or other platforms — only Unity Learn seems to be affecte
I’ve searched the forums, Googled the problem, and even asked AI tools for help — but nothing has worked so far.
Could Unity please look into this? Also, would it be possible to expose video quality settings on Unity Learn? That way, we could manually reduce the quality if bandwidth or streaming performance is an issue.

I have the very same problem. when I open any of the courses, the page starts loading all of the videos at once which makes things insufferably slow. then I open one video in another tab by itself to witness this:
apparently a 104 seconds video is 218mb in size and the maximum speed I’m getting is 0.5mb (I should be getting at least 4 times that amount). there’s no way I’m going to be able to watch this video properly.
